Output 573e2246cbc21c27fdec69a59aa1796d04ad6a707d93bb0a7802c48ef26619ca:13

value
4249917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 925c17d362bb51fe379973f9707a0911eba4a219 OP_EQUAL
address
3F2tuHkYdT5Y4BaqN5sbjFdMdpRone2EXe
transaction
573e2246cbc21c27fdec69a59aa1796d04ad6a707d93bb0a7802c48ef26619ca
confirmations
382615
spent
true